Average adult sizes for male and female C. porosus are 4.6–5.2 metres (15–17 feet) and 3.1–3.4 metres (10 feet 2 inches–11 feet 1 inch), respectively, with outsize males occasionally achieving 6 metres (19 feet 8 inches) or, on rare occasions, even 7 metres (22 feet 11 inches). 40 cm x 30 cm x 23 cm A crocodile skull A stuffed crocodile , poised to strike with open jaw, Sepik river, Papua New Guinea, length 117 cm How Crocodiles Hunt. When he died, his length was 5.42 meters (17.8 ft) and weight was 860 kg (1896 pounds) - as confirmed by St. Augustine Alligator Farm - and possibly between 60 and 80 years old. There are numerous species of crocodiles, ranging from the dwarf crocodile, which seldom grows beyond a length of 1.5 m (5 ft), to the saltwater crocodile, which attains a length of 4 - 5.5 m (13 - 18 ft) at full growth. Saltwater crocodiles above 6 m (19.7 feet) were certainly much more common in Australia and SE Asia before extensive hunting for their skins in the 1940's, 50's and 60's wiped out the big crocodiles.
